Decoding cancer circulating transcriptomic signatures with language models
GeneLLM is presented, a Transformer-based model that directly processes the nucleotide sequences of human-mapped cfRNA reads to identify cancer-indicative signatures and allows accurate cancer classification from plasma biopsies, suggesting that sequence-level modelling of plasma cfRNA can capture diagnostically relevant information beyond annotation-dependent approaches.
